Ukraine ready to set egg, poultry, sugar exports to Poland at 2022-2023 levels

MOSCOW. Feb 26 (Interfax) - Ukraine is ready to set egg, poultry and sugar exports to Poland at the 2022-2023 levels, Ukrainian Prime Minister Denis Shmygal said.

"We introduced a mechanism for verification and control of four grain groups on September 16. We are ready to do more and set egg, poultry and sugar exports at the 2022-2023 levels. These are rather large amounts. We are ready to set them and operate within these boundaries," Ukrainian media quoted Shmygal as saying at the Ukraine. Year 2024 forum on Sunday.

Speaking of Polish farmers' protests at the Ukrainian-Polish border, he said that the Polish government and police gave a proper response to the protests and opened related cases. The first perpetrators are standing trial and facing up to five years in jail.
